On Wednesday, researchers and religious leaders shared the results of a two-month artistic experiment conducted in a Swiss Catholic chapel. The project featured a computer screen avatar of "Jesus" placed in a confessional, where it answered visitors' questions about faith, morality, and contemporary issues using Scripture-based responses. About 900 anonymous conversations were recorded, with some visitors returning multiple times. The organizers deemed the project a success, noting that many visitors left feeling contemplative and found the interaction straightforward. Chapel theologian Marco Schmid, who led the initiative, observed that participants engaged seriously with the avatar rather than joking around.

Schmid emphasized that the "AI Jesus, " described as a "Jesus-like" persona, was an artistic endeavor designed to provoke thought about the relationship between the digital and divine. It was never intended to replace human interaction, sacramental confessions with a priest, or conserve pastoral resources. "It was clear to people that it was a computer and not a confession, " Schmid noted. "It wasn't programmed to offer absolutions or prayers. " Schmid added that the project was meant to be temporary, but there are discussions about possibly reviving it in the future.
